The strike of fifty teachers in the Jewish elementary schools in the Roumanian capital was ended today. The teachers demanded payment of their December salaries. Eleven schools with an enrollment of 1,000 children were closed for several days on account of the conflict.
A debate between Professor Harry Elmer Barnes of Smith College and Rabbi Nathan Krass of Temple Emanu-El was held Wednesday night at the Community Church, New York. Their topic was “Do We Need a New Concept of God?”
